Abstract:
Excellent hydrophobicity and hydrophobicity migration property of silicone rubber material guarantee outstanding pollution resistance and insulation performance of composite insulators in outdoor insulation. Under effect of multiple environmental factors, insulators get aged with increase of service duration. In this paper, hydrophobicity recovery characteristics are revealed by static contact angle method of different kinds of laboratory aged samples, that is, corona aged and salt contaminated HTV(high temperature vulcanized) SR(silicone rubber) samples. The experimental results indicate relationship between hydrophobicity change and ageing status of HTV silicone rubber. At last, influencing factors of static contact angle method and problems existing are discussed when the method is applied to estimate surface condition of salt contaminated samples.
